    Exam Overview

    The Huawei H12-811 exam is structured to evaluate candidates comprehensively on a variety of networking domains. It is designed to be completed within 90 minutes and typically consists of around 60 questions. The exam features multiple-choice questions, drag-and-drop exercises, and scenario-based questions that require a clear understanding of networking principles and Huawei-specific technologies.

    The passing score for the H12-811 exam is 600 out of 1000, ensuring that only candidates with a solid grasp of networking concepts can earn the certification. The exam fee is approximately $200 USD, and it is offered in multiple languages, including English, Chinese, Spanish, Russian, and Japanese. The exam is delivered online through the Pearson VUE platform, allowing candidates to take the test from the comfort of their home or any approved testing center.

    Candidates are encouraged to review the exam objectives in detail before attempting the test. Huawei provides an official exam blueprint that outlines the knowledge areas and weightage for each domain. This blueprint is an essential resource for candidates to structure their preparation effectively and focus on high-priority topics that carry more weight in the exam.

    Exam Domains and Weightage

    The H12-811 exam covers a wide range of topics that are crucial for understanding data communication networks. The exam domains are structured to ensure candidates develop a well-rounded knowledge of networking concepts, practical configuration, and troubleshooting skills. The main exam domains and their approximate weightage are as follows:

    • Data Communication and Network Basics – 8 percent

    • Building an IP Network with Interconnection and Interworking – 27 percent

    • Ethernet Switching Network Construction – 28 percent

    • Cyber Security Infrastructure and Network Access – 8 percent

    • Network Services and Applications – 5 percent

    • WLAN Basics – 10 percent

    • WAN Basics – 3 percent

    • Network Management and Operations & Maintenance – 3 percent

    • IPv6 Basics – 5 percent

    • SDN and Automation Basics – 3 percent

    Each domain is carefully designed to test candidates on both theoretical knowledge and practical skills. For example, the Ethernet Switching Network Construction domain requires understanding VLAN configurations, spanning tree protocols, and Layer 2 switching mechanisms, whereas the IP Network domain focuses on routing protocols, IP addressing, subnetting, and network interconnection techniques.

    Data Communication and Network Basics

    The foundational domain of Data Communication and Network Basics emphasizes understanding the fundamental principles of networking. This includes the OSI and TCP/IP models, data transmission methods, network topologies, and common networking devices such as routers, switches, firewalls, and access points. Candidates must be familiar with concepts such as packet switching, circuit switching, and error detection methods, which form the basis of modern network communication.

    Additionally, understanding network protocols such as TCP, UDP, HTTP, FTP, and ICMP is critical for troubleshooting and network management. This domain ensures that candidates grasp the essential building blocks of network communication, enabling them to configure, monitor, and troubleshoot network devices effectively.

    Building an IP Network with Interconnection and Interworking

    The IP network domain forms the backbone of the H12-811 exam, carrying significant weight in the overall scoring. Candidates are expected to understand IP addressing, subnetting, and VLAN segmentation, as well as dynamic routing protocols such as OSPF, RIP, and static routing configurations. Inter-network communication, gateway configuration, and inter-VLAN routing are also key topics.

    This domain tests the ability to design IP networks that are scalable, efficient, and reliable. Candidates must be able to identify optimal routing paths, configure IP interfaces, and troubleshoot common routing issues. A strong understanding of Layer 3 devices, including routers and multilayer switches, is essential to excel in this domain.

    Ethernet Switching Network Construction

    Ethernet switching is a core component of modern networks, and the H12-811 exam dedicates substantial focus to this area. Candidates need to understand Layer 2 switching principles, including MAC address tables, VLAN implementation, trunking, and spanning tree protocol. Knowledge of EtherChannel, port security, and switch configuration is critical for building reliable Ethernet networks.

    Switching also involves understanding broadcast domains, collision domains, and methods to optimize traffic flow. Hands-on practice with switch configuration and troubleshooting is highly recommended to reinforce theoretical knowledge. Candidates must demonstrate proficiency in configuring VLANs, implementing inter-switch connections, and resolving network loops using appropriate protocols.

    Cyber Security Infrastructure and Network Access

    Network security is an increasingly vital component of any data communication network. In this domain, candidates are tested on basic network security concepts, including access control, authentication, encryption, and firewall implementation. Understanding how to secure network devices, manage user permissions, and protect against common attacks such as DoS and MITM is essential.

    Additionally, network access control mechanisms, VPN configuration, and secure wireless access are part of the exam objectives. This domain ensures that candidates can implement fundamental security practices to protect sensitive data and maintain network integrity.

    Network Services and Applications

    Network services such as DNS, DHCP, NAT, and IP addressing management are critical for maintaining a functional network. Candidates must understand how to configure these services and troubleshoot common issues. Additionally, knowledge of network applications, including VoIP, video conferencing, and cloud-based services, is tested to evaluate a candidate’s ability to manage real-world networking scenarios.

    Understanding how network services interact with the underlying infrastructure is key to optimizing performance and ensuring network reliability. This domain requires both conceptual knowledge and practical application skills.

    WLAN Basics

    Wireless networking is a key component of modern IT environments, and the exam includes a dedicated domain for WLAN basics. Candidates are expected to understand wireless standards, frequency bands, access point configuration, and wireless security protocols such as WPA, WPA2, and WPA3.

    Practical knowledge of wireless deployment, coverage optimization, and interference mitigation is also important. Candidates must be able to configure basic wireless networks and troubleshoot connectivity issues, ensuring seamless integration with wired network infrastructures.

    WAN Basics

    Wide Area Networks (WANs) enable communication over large geographical distances. This domain focuses on WAN technologies, including leased lines, MPLS, VPNs, and broadband connections. Candidates should understand routing across WAN links, QoS implementation, and performance optimization for distributed networks.

    Understanding WAN topologies, latency, bandwidth management, and troubleshooting techniques is essential for ensuring connectivity and reliability across remote sites. Candidates are expected to apply these concepts in real-world scenarios to maintain effective network operations.

    Network Management and Operations & Maintenance

    Effective network management is crucial for monitoring, maintaining, and optimizing network performance. This domain covers network monitoring tools, SNMP, syslog, configuration management, and troubleshooting techniques. Candidates must be able to identify network issues, analyze logs, and apply corrective measures efficiently.

    Knowledge of operations and maintenance best practices, including backup, restore, and firmware updates, ensures network stability and security. This domain tests a candidate’s ability to manage network resources proactively and respond to incidents effectively.

    IPv6 Basics

    As IPv4 addresses become increasingly scarce, understanding IPv6 is vital for modern network engineers. This domain introduces IPv6 addressing, subnetting, and configuration. Candidates must be familiar with the differences between IPv4 and IPv6, as well as the transition mechanisms such as dual-stack and tunneling.

    IPv6 knowledge is critical for future-proofing networks and ensuring compatibility with emerging technologies. Candidates should be able to configure IPv6 interfaces, route IPv6 traffic, and troubleshoot IPv6-related issues.

    SDN and Automation Basics

    Software-Defined Networking (SDN) and network automation are becoming integral parts of modern networking. This domain introduces the concepts of SDN, network programmability, and basic automation using scripts and APIs. Candidates should understand the benefits of centralized network control, dynamic configuration, and automated network management.

    Practical exposure to SDN controllers, network configuration tools, and automation scripts helps candidates implement efficient network operations. This knowledge is particularly valuable for network engineers aiming to work in advanced or large-scale network environments.
